Grand Designs Live London takes place at the ExCeL in London's Docklands and has easy access to public transport, ample parking and plenty of places to eat and drink.

ExCeL Address

One Western Gateway
Royal Victoria Dock
London
E16 1XL

Travel Information

Transport By Road

When driving to ExCeL London follow signs for Royal Docks, City Airport and ExCeL. There is easy access from the M25, M11, A406 and A13.

All onsite parking is pay and display, with the exception of the Royal Victoria multi-storey car park, which is located at the west end of the site. Parking in the Royal Victoria multi-storey car park can be paid for at one of the three pay points located within the car park at the end of your visit (the machines are located on level two and level zero and all machines accept both cash and credit card).

Parking charges across ExCeL on site locations are as follows:

Up to 2 hours - £5.00

Up to 6 hours - £10.00

Transport By tube

The Jubilee Line is recommended as the quickest route to ExCeL London. Alight at Canning Town and change onto a Beckton-bound DLR train, for the quick 2-stop journey to Custom House for ExCeL (West).

Transport By River & Cable Car

The Emirates Air Line (Cable Car) connects ExCeL London and the O2 arena. It's now possible to travel by Thames Clipper between central London and the O2 and then by Cable Car across the Thames to ExCeL London.

Disabled access at ExCeL London

ExCeL requires disabled visitors to be afforded the same opportunities as able-bodied visitors enjoy, and to this extent organisers must ensure that exhibition stands are easily accessible to visitors using wheelchairs

ExCeL has been purposely designed and built to allow unrestricted access to disabled visitors and to conform to Part M of the Building Regulations.
